MATCHING GRANT FOR BUSINESS START-UPS
Articles courtesy of SMIDEC:Small & Medium Industries Development Corporation |
OBJECTIVE
The scheme provides assistance to assist start-up of businesses.
QUALIFYING CRITERIA
· Manufacturing companies or companies providing manufacturing related services Incorporated under the Companies Act 1965 or enterprises in the manufacturing sector incorporated under the Registration of Business Ordinance 1956 with annual sales turnover of not exceeding RM25 million or full-time employees not exceeding 150
· For the services sector, businesses incorporated under the Registration of Business Ordinance 1956 with an annual sales turnover of not exceeding RM5 million or full-time employees not exceeding 50
· At least 60% equity held by Malaysians
· Possess valid premise license and in operation not more than 12 months
SECTOR COVERAGE
· Manufacturing
· Manufacturing Related Services**
· Services (excluding insurance and financial services)
FORM OF ASSISTANCE
Assistance is given in the form of a matching grant where 50% of the approved project cost is borne by the Government and the remainder by the applicant. For enterprises in the manufacturing sector*, incorporated under the Registration of Business Ordinance 1956, assistance is given up to 80% of the approved cost. The maximum grant allocated per application is RM 100,000
ELIGIBLE EXPENSES
Expenses incurred in starting up a business, including:
· Preparation of Business Planning
· Related Feasibility Studies
· Rental of incubators and business premises up to 24 months
· Rental of equipment and machineries
· Development of prototype
· Product sample and testing
· Purchase of machinery or office equipment
· One year broadband subscription fee
** Main activities under manufacturing related services are:
· Research and Development ( R & D) such as product/ process development and software development
· Product and Process Design
· Distribution and Logistics such as warehousing, freight forwarding, bulk breaking, international procurement centre, haulage
· Marketing such as packaging and market research
· Environmental Management
· Other related services such as engineering support services, gas sterilization services, calibration and testing services
